When Your Success Triggers Others— Handling Silent Doubters and Secret Critics

In this 12th episode of The Erin Coupe Podcast, Erin explores the uncomfortable reality that success can often trigger negative reactions from others, including envy, passive-aggressive behaviors, and even outright sabotage. She unpacks why people get triggered by success, how to recognize when someone secretly wants you to fail, and strategies for rising above it and staying focused on your goals.


Episode Highlights:
- Success acts as a mirror, reflecting the internal fears and insecurities of others. People often feel threatened by your growth and accomplishments.
- Relationship dynamics can shift when one person starts to achieve more, and not everyone knows how to handle that.
- Common reactions to success include passive-aggressive comments like "it must be nice" and undermining efforts.
- Society tends to glorify the underdog but resent the winner, leading to a desire for successful people to fail.
- Erin shares personal experiences of receiving negative reactions to her own success and business growth.


Key Takeaways for YOU:
1. Unapologetic Ambition - Don't dim your light to make others comfortable. Stay true to your growth and ambition.
2. Boundary Setting - Set boundaries with negative energy and limit interactions with those who drain your energy.
3. Supportive Circles - Surround yourself with people who genuinely support and uplift you, not those who secretly hope for your failure.
4. Humble Confidence - Stay humble and unapologetic about your success. Focus on your goals and keep shining brightly.
5. Conscious Energy Management - Pay attention to the energy people bring into your life and be conscious of where you invest your resources.
